Public praised after Desmond disruptions
The work of the emergency services over the last few days has been oustanding.
That's according to Inspector Derek Flint.
Stormy conditions have devastated large regions across the Island since Thursday.
Police, fire crews, the Department of Infrastructure and the Civil Defence are among services helping the worst hit areas.
